Lee Chamberlin, an actress whose career took off when she joined Bill Cosby and Rita Moreno on the funky 1970s childrens show The Electric Company, died on May 25 in Chapel Hill, N.C. She was 76. She also appeared in the movies Uptown Saturday Night (1974) and Lets Do It Again (1975), both directed by Sidney Poitier and starring Mr. Poitier and Mr. Cosby. From 1983 to 1995, she was the supportive mother of the character played by Debbi Morgan on the ABC soap opera All My Children, her longest recurring part. Chamberlin was a regular performer during the first two years of the esteemed series The Electric Company,[4] and she made guest appearances in the television series What's Happening!
